Output 62281fb07cc411cd812c43d341314141acf2291308f1647491a1eddf47ad28fd:0

value
106313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c92a3d5346ef65224689b77fc3ae5d4135945f0 OP_EQUAL
address
3MoJFUEQtvKMuat1hXAAgRthU2HEyzen2r
transaction
62281fb07cc411cd812c43d341314141acf2291308f1647491a1eddf47ad28fd
confirmations
387957
spent
true